About Old North

Spanning from Arzolorov Street to Park Hayarkon, the Old North is a well-kept neighbourhood full of classy sea-facing bistros serving Mediterranean delicacies as well as chic cafés and mainstream shopping streets. Its most famous street is Dizengoff Street. Even though many of the shops are high-end, the restaurants and bars are affordable, and many Tel-Avivians come here to enjoy a drink in some of the stylish cocktail bars that are dotted along the street and its offshoots.

Visit the Historical Home of Ben Gurion

Visit the Historical Home of Ben Gurion

This home served as the official family home of Ben Gurion from 1931 to 1953. Today, it's a historic house museum that's open to visitors who want to learn more about Ben Gurion.
